
12 mighty men showed up in the middle of a blinding rainstorm for lots of splashing, grunting, lying and mutual mockery at 45 Minutes of Mary. Here’s how it went down:
Mosey to corner of Grove & Westmoreland
COP (In Cadence): SSH 20x, Don Quixote (Abe Vigoda) 10x, Arm Circles forward/backward/small/big 5x, 10 Hand Release ‘Mericans, 20 LBCs
Splash through the puddles to the paved area by the track on the other side of the school
Double-Dora 1-2-3
Partner up, then partner with another set of partners. One team knocks out exercises while other runs.
Stage One: 100 ‘Mericans, 200 LBCs, 300 squats :: plank for the six
Swap partners just like a West End Lasagna Party
Stage Two: 100 Carolina drydocks, 200 crabcakes, 300 jump squats :: Al Gore for the six
Puddle of Love: Tunnel of Love, just with 100% more puddles
Triple-Check: Balls to the wall, World War II Sit Ups, Runner sets pace by running across paved area to fence and back. Six inches for the six.
Mosey to basketball courts for a quick layup circuit, then circle up for quick Ring of Fire
Mosey back to the flag where we found it had fallen over in the rain. Two minutes of burpees as penalty.
Three of minutes of Mary: Dead cockroaches, LBCs, Alabama Prom Dates, Superman
Numberama, Namarama, YHC took us out.
